The size of Dawes Point is approximately 0.1 square kilometres. It has 5 parks covering nearly 23.6% of total area. The population of Dawes Point in 2011 was 544 people. By 2016 the population was 339 showing a population decline of 37.7%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Dawes Point is 50-59 years. Households in Dawes Point are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Dawes Point work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 44% of the homes in Dawes Point were owner-occupied compared with 62.3% in 2016.
